Between 2020 and 2023, gaming chair technology evolved significantly with the introduction of 4D armrests, improved lumbar support systems, memory foam padding, and multi-tilt mechanisms replacing the basic rock-and-tilt designs of earlier chairs. Ergonomic research increasingly influenced gaming chair design during this period, narrowing the gap between gaming chairs and premium office seating.
The 2020 to 2023 period marked a maturation phase for gaming chair design. Prior to 2020, most gaming chairs offered a racing-seat aesthetic with limited ergonomic adjustment. The COVID-19 lockdowns of 2020 and 2021 drove millions of people into work-from-home and study-from-home setups, dramatically increasing demand for seating that could handle eight or more hours of daily use rather than the two to three hours of casual gaming the original designs assumed.
This demand shift forced manufacturers to improve adjustment systems. 4D armrests, which adjust in height, width, depth, and angle, became standard on mid-range and premium gaming chairs by 2022 whereas they had previously been reserved for top-tier models. Multi-function tilt mechanisms that allow independent seat tilt and backrest recline replaced the single-axis rock mechanisms that caused discomfort during extended sessions.
Lumbar support systems also advanced considerably. Fixed foam lumbar pillows, which were universal before 2020, gave way to adjustable lumbar systems integrated into the chair frame. These integrated systems maintain lower back support across different sitting positions rather than being fixed in one location.
PU leather, the material that defined early gaming chair aesthetics, showed its limits during the longer daily use patterns of 2020 to 2023. PU leather chairs in South African climates, where summer temperatures push above 35 degrees Celsius, trapped heat and cracked faster than manufacturers anticipated. By 2022, fabric and mesh gaming chairs became widely available, offering better breathability for SA gaming conditions.
Memory foam padding replaced the dense polyurethane foam of earlier chairs. Memory foam distributes weight more evenly and recovers shape more reliably after extended compression. For South African gamers in Johannesburg, Durban, or any city where multi-hour gaming sessions are common, the upgrade from standard foam to memory foam reduced fatigue measurably during long sessions.
Seat density improvements also addressed a common complaint: gaming chairs that felt firm initially but compressed into inadequate padding within six to twelve months of regular use. Chairs released from 2022 onward generally used higher-density seat foam that maintained its support profile for longer.
Understanding this evolution helps SA buyers make better purchase decisions. A chair designed and manufactured before 2020 or using pre-2020 design specifications, even if sold new today, may lack the ergonomic adjustment range and material quality of chairs designed from 2021 onward. Check when the chair model was designed rather than just when it was stocked locally.
For South African buyers, local stock availability is also a consideration. Chairs with advanced adjustment systems are sometimes more expensive here due to import costs and the rand exchange rate. A chair in the R3,500 to R6,000 range that uses post-2021 ergonomic design standards is often better value than a premium-branded chair with pre-2020 internals at a similar or higher price.
The shift from fixed lumbar pillows to adjustable integrated lumbar systems was the most impactful ergonomic improvement. This change allowed gaming chairs to support users of different heights and sitting styles without requiring constant manual pillow repositioning.
A quality 2020-era gaming chair is still usable if the foam has not compressed significantly and the adjustment mechanisms work correctly. However, chairs designed after 2021 with 4D armrests and integrated lumbar systems provide meaningfully better ergonomic support for extended daily use.
PU leather gaming chairs trap heat significantly in South Africa's warm summers. Fabric or mesh gaming chairs released from 2021 onward handle South African summer conditions much better and are worth considering for year-round comfort in cities like Durban and Pretoria.
